The Importance of Oxygen Systems: Military aircraft operate in diverse and demanding environments, from high-altitude reconnaissance missions to combat sorties in hostile territories. In such scenarios, ensuring a continuous and reliable oxygen supply is paramount for the safety and effectiveness of aircrews. Oxygen systems not only sustain life but also contribute to optimal cognitive function and performance, enabling pilots to execute their missions with precision and confidence.

Key Trends and Innovations: One of the prominent trends in the military aircraft oxygen systems market is the integration of advanced monitoring and diagnostic capabilities. Modern oxygen systems are equipped with sensors and telemetry systems that provide real-time data on oxygen levels, cabin pressure, and physiological parameters. This enables proactive maintenance, early detection of issues, and improved situational awareness for aircrew and ground personnel.

Another significant innovation is the development of lightweight and compact oxygen systems that offer enhanced performance and efficiency. Advances in materials science and engineering have led to the creation of oxygen storage and delivery systems that are more robust, reliable, and adaptable to different aircraft platforms. Additionally, the integration of modular and scalable architectures allows for easier installation, maintenance, and upgrades, reducing overall lifecycle costs.
